USUST Rector Joins the Ceremonial Unveiling of the Monumental Tryzub in Dnipro

On 24 December 2025, in the very heart of Dnipro – on the square near the Dnipropetrovsk Regional Military Administration and the Regional Council, close to the Rocket Park – the ceremonial opening of a monumental Tryzub took place. This powerful symbol of resilience, remembrance, and unity of the Ukrainian people was installed on the eve of Christmas and the New Year as a gift to the city from the defenders of Ukraine. The initiative came from the servicemen of the 7th Rapid Response Corps of the Air Assault Forces and the 25th Separate Airborne Sicheslav Brigade of the Armed Forces of Ukraine.
 
The location was deliberately chosen. Here in 2014 and 2022 volunteer battalions were formed and volunteer coordination centers operated, an experience that resonates deeply with many local residents and veterans. The monumental Tryzub has become a symbol of Ukrainian identity and courage, as well as a tribute to fallen brothers-in-arms who gave their lives in the struggle for independence and freedom.

The organizers noted that the creation and installation of the monument was carried out in close cooperation with partners over several weeks. The representatives of the Charitable Fund ‘7th Corps of the Air Assault Forces’ said that it was essential for them to install the Tryzub precisely at this location, which holds deep historical significance for both the local community and the defenders.
